INFORMATION EMPOWERMENT:
RESOURCE DISCOVERY & MANAGEMENT
The UK Online User Group is a Special Interest Group of the Institute of
Information Scientists. Established in 1978, it is a national user group for
online, CD-ROM and Internet searchers. Members benefit from a comprehensive
range of meetings and workshops along with a variety of practical publications.

This is the 9th UKOLUG biennial Conference. The programme will address the
practical concerns and considerations facing information professionals in 2000.
It will explore the challenge of acquiring and managing resources in an
increasingly complex global Internet market. It will be of interest to anyone
who wishes to keep up to date with the latest themes and developments
surrounding resource discovery and management.
All professionals involved in the delivery of information services across all
sectors, including librarians, information scientists, library and information
science students and information specialists in business, law, commerce,
science, academia, research and the public sector will benefit from the broad
mix of speakers and breakout papers. There will also be plenty of opportunity
for questions and discussion.
